欢迎访问宙启技术站
智能推送

Numpy模块中的__file__()方法解析:快速找到Numpy模块的具体位置。

发布时间:2024-01-04 07:20:08

在NumPy模块中,__file__()方法是一个内置的函数,用于返回模块的具体位置。它可以帮助我们快速找到NumPy模块在系统中的位置。

使用__file__()方法可以通过以下步骤找到NumPy模块的位置:

1. 首先,导入NumPy模块:

   import numpy as np
   

2. 然后,使用__file__()方法获取NumPy模块的文件路径:

   print(np.__file__)
   

这将输出NumPy模块的具体位置,例如:

   C:\Python\lib\site-packages
umpy\__init__.py
   

在此示例中,NumPy模块位于C:\Python\lib\site-packages

umpy\目录下。

通过__file__()方法可以快速找到NumPy模块的确切位置,这在调试和查找模块问题时非常有用。

以下是一个完整的示例,演示了如何使用__file__()方法找到NumPy模块的位置:

import numpy as np

# 获取NumPy模块的文件路径
numpy_location = np.__file__

# 输出NumPy模块的位置
print("NumPy模块的位置:", numpy_location)

输出:

NumPy模块的位置: C:\Python\lib\site-packages
umpy\__init__.py

在这个示例中,我们导入了NumPy模块,并使用__file__()方法找到了它的位置,并将结果打印出来。

总之,__file__()方法是NumPy模块中一个有用的函数,它可以帮助我们快速找到NumPy模块的确切位置。这个方法对于调试和查找模块问题非常有帮助。请注意,__file__()方法返回的是文件路径,而不是目录路径。